I was a Logic user for PC for years, and I have switched to MAC because of Logic Pro.
When Emagic stopped PC Logic update, I also tried to switche to another software, I tried Cubase, but I found it's plug-in quality is really bad ,and if you want I high quality plug-in , you must pay more money,and it's GUI is really a foolish design, it make me work like a technique guy instead of music composer, and I find I can compose nothing with Cubase . But Logic is really wonderful tool made for composer, I can make my working invirments according to my habit and my hardware, so every time I start Logic I can immediately get into the music compose instead of finding a folder where to put your music project whatever it's good or bad.

Another thing make me switched to MAC is that the Logic Pro 's Space Designer reverb and it's frezze functiion. I made game orchestral music for time, reverb is very important in orchestral music, but I have not enough money to buy those DSP card like UAD-1 or TC Power Core, and I want to say that in PC , Logic 's reverb plug-in is just so so , so I trid many revrb plug-in , I found that N.I Reactor's Space Master's plug-in is really a very nice reverb Pulg-in used for Hall reverb for the orchestral music. But when I switch to MAC I found Emagic's Space Designer is much better than N.I Reactor's Space Master, so I neednot have to buy Reactor again.

Another thing is Logic Pro's Freeze function, I trid Cubase and Nenodo's freeze, it's really so slow,but in Logic I can finish 3min 20 tracks's freeze in 1 minute.
It really help me out of CPU overolad.


So I am very happy that I switch to MAC and still own Logic in my music life.

the differnce in logics and cubases sound is proabaly becuase they default to different setings for the panning laws - did you change them ?

get traktion - and be completely unable to work with video, midi (comparitively speaking), have a useless freeze function (yes folks unfreezing everything is useless if you have a lot frozen cos that cpu meter goes straight to 100%)and lack of multi monitor support

besides its not environment templates - its taoilring the workings of every aspect of the program to your own needs OK

Now I don't think it matters that much, but there is a difference in DAWs, not enough to color your own ability to make a bad or great mix though.

For instance using Absynth tracks of the exact same sound with the exact same MIDI track to see how much more CPU efficient Logic is than Live on my mac, there was a noticeable difference in the way the multiple instances of the same notes sounded in each app.

If your curious, the G4 ran the 16 maximum Absynths in Logic, yet only 7 in Live 4. So personally THAT's what I'd miss the most if I switched all the way to Live, or some other app, the efficient CPU use of Logic.
